A free press is "even more important" than an independent judiciary in moves to combat corruption in Malaysia, said Param Cumaraswamy, the new president of Transparency International Malaysia.

In an exclusive interview with malaysiakini on what it would take to reduce corruption, he said the government's stated mission would not succeed without press freedom.

"I put a lot of premium on press freedom. Sometimes, I say it is even more important than an independent judiciary. A free press is vital for an effective democracy," he said.
